π‘ PDF to Markdown Tips
Best for Text-Heavy PDFs
Works best on PDFs that are mostly text; image-heavy or scanned pages need OCR first.
Review Heading Levels
A PDF's visual formatting doesn't always map cleanly onto Markdown headings, so a quick pass afterward helps.
Expect Text Only
Images, exact fonts, and page layout are not carried over into the Markdown output.
Use It as a Starting Point
Treat the output as a first draft to clean up, not a guaranteed one-to-one formatting match.
